When Did Roland Garros 2024 Start?
The 2024 French Open began on Sunday, May 26, and concluded with the finals on Sunday, June 9, 2024.
- Opening Match Time: 11:00 AM (Local Time, Paris)
- Night Sessions: 8:30 PM (Local Time)
- Matches were broadcast worldwide on networks like Eurosport, NBC, and Tennis Channel, depending on region.
Roland Garros 2024 Prize Money & Net Worth Impact
This year’s French Open had a record prize pool.
- Total Prize Money: €53.5 million
- Men’s & Women’s Singles Winners: €2.4 million each
- Doubles Winners: €590,000
Winning Roland Garros greatly boosts a player’s net worth, via prize earnings, endorsements, and ranking bonuses.

Historic Significance of Roland Garros
Held annually in Paris, Roland Garros is one of the four Grand Slam tournaments and is widely considered the most physically demanding due to its clay surface.
Past legends include:
- Rafael Nadal (14-time winner)
- Chris Evert (7-time winner)
- Steffi Graf, Roger Federer, Novak Djokovic
